The Care Your Child Needs, with an Educational Approach That Will Make Them Shine

Every child deserves the best care and attention, but also a nurturing environment that fosters growth and development. Scientific research shows that early childhood is a critical period for brain development, with up to 90% of a child’s brain developing by age five. By combining personalized care with an educational approach, we can lay the foundation for lifelong success.

My approach emphasizes creativity, emotional growth, and cognitive development, which are all essential for a child’s well-being. Studies indicate that engaging children in creative activities, such as drawing, music, and imaginative play, significantly enhances their problem-solving skills and emotional intelligence. Additionally, a strong emotional foundation at an early age has been linked to better academic performance and healthier social interactions later in life.

By providing a safe and stimulating environment, I ensure your child receives not only the care they need but also the educational experiences that promote curiosity and confidence. Research has shown that children who receive early educational support are more likely to succeed in school and develop critical thinking skills that will serve them throughout their lives.
